About the role

Balfour Beatty has an exciting opportunity for an Area Quality Manager to join our Regional team to work in the Central and South of England and Wales.


Role Purpose



  • Work across an area (Delivery Unit) or on a major project to support the operations teams to consistently deliver to the required quality - to achieve 'defect free delivery' and 'right first time'. Also, to undertake operational inspections and audits for the Business Unit to check compliance with drawings, specifications, procedures and good practice and identify opportunities for improvement;

  • To be the Delivery Unit (or project) expert practitioner to provide 'hands on' specialist support and be part of the England & Wales network of Quality Managers to drive improvements.

  • The Manager will be expected to spend the majority of their time out on projects supporting delivery teams.

  • A lot of travel is required across the South of England and Wales.

What you'll be doing


As an Area Quality Manager you will be:


  • Working with our teams from preconstruction through construction and into post-construction to help us deliver defect free, high quality projects;

  • Supporting the business in the implementation of our quality systems and processes across our projects;

  • Ensuring that we continually drive improvement in quality by promoting best practice and sharing lessons to ensure we avoid repetition of poor installations and material selections;

  • Provide our project teams with expertise on buildability or seek others who can assist in the pursuit of better material selections, improved detailing and processes that increase quality;

  • Support and champion the integration of Modern Methods of Construction and off-site manufacture to drive high quality installations on our sites.



Who we're looking for

Essential Personal Qualities and Experience:



  • A background in Civils;

  • Previous experience of leading a Quality Team/Project;

  • Confident in working with Senior Management and able to challenge existing ways of working to support business improvement;

  • Can work within a multi-discipline team;

  • Able to command respect across the business;

  • Is good at building relationships and can influence effectively.
